Hvordan installere homebrew på mac

Hvordan installere homebrew på mac

Homebrew er et gratis pakkehåndteringssystem som brukes til å installere, fjerne og oppdatere pakkene på macOS ved hjelp av terminalkommandoer. Homebrew forenkler installasjonen av pakker på macOS og hjelper utviklerne til å effektivisere arbeidet sitt. Denne opplæringen er en guide for hvordan du installerer og bruker homebrew på en Mac. Siden Homebrew er en terminalbasert pakkeansvarlig, må du kjenne funksjonen til terminalen på Mac.

Terminal, også kjent som kommandolinjegrensesnitt er en app som lar deg samhandle med systemet på en ikke-grafisk måte. Terminal kan være skremmende for alle som er nye på det, men likevel har det mye potensiale da det lar deg automatisere oppgaver du utfører på systemet ditt.

Homebrew-kommandoer gjør det enkelt å installere open source-pakker og utviklerverktøy på Mac-maskiner, da Mac-maskiner ikke kommer med pakkesjefen. La oss finne ut hvordan du installerer Homebrew på en Mac:

Forutsetninger

Følgende forutsetninger er nødvendige for å installere Homebrew på en Mac:

  • Et system med macOS (Mojave og senere)
  • Bruker med administrative privilegier

Hvordan installere homebrew på mac

Å installere homebrew på en Mac er en 2 -trinns prosess:

  1. Installere Xcode -kommandolinjeverktøy
  2. Installere Homebrew

Homebrew -funksjonalitet avhenger av Xcode -kommandolinjeverktøy, det må installeres før du installerer Homebrew. La oss finne ut hvordan du installerer Xcode Command Line Tools Mac.

1: Hvordan installere Xcode -kommandolinjeverktøy på Mac

For å installere homebrew på en Mac må du ha Xcode -kommandolinjeverktøy installert på systemet ditt, da Homebrew trenger disse verktøyene for å fungere.

Xcode er en IDE fra Apple for å utvikle iOS, iPados og MacOS -baserte applikasjoner, hvis den allerede er installert på systemet ditt, trenger du ikke å installere Xcode -kommandolinjeverktøy. Men hvis den ikke er installert, trenger du ikke å installere hele Xcode IDE, da det vil ta omtrent 10 GB lagringsplass, i stedet installere Xcode -kommandolinjeverktøyene.

Først åpen terminal på Macen din ved å trykke Kommando + romfelt Nøkler, søk terminal og slå enter for å åpne den:

Skriv inn følgende kommando for å sjekke om Xcode -kommandolinjeverktøyene er installert eller ikke:

xcode -Select -p

Kommandoen ovenfor skriver ut den aktive utviklerkatalogen, hvis du får en feil, så betyr det at Xcode -kommandolinjeverktøyene ikke er installert:

For å installere Xcode -kommandolinjeverktøy, bruk kommandoen gitt nedenfor:

Xcode-Select-Installer

En dialogboks vises klikk Installere:

Bli enige de Lisensavtale:

Nedlastingen begynner:

Klikk Ferdig Når nedlastingen er ferdig:

Kontroller installasjonen av Xcode -kommandolinjeverktøy ved å bruke:

Xcode -Select -V

For å sjekke utviklerbanen Bruk:

xcode -Select -p

Xcode -kommandolinjens verktøy er installert på systemet ditt og går nå mot neste trinn.

Hvordan installere homebrew på mac

Det er to hovedtyper av Mac -maskiner er tilgjengelige:

  1. Intel-basert Mac (Intel i5, i7)
  2. Apple Silicon Based Mac (M1/M2)

Prosessen med hjemmebrygginstallasjon på en av typen maskiner er lik, men Mac -maskiner basert på Apple Silicon krever et ekstra trinn som vil bli diskutert i følgende avsnitt.

I: Hvordan installere Homebrew på en Intel-basert Mac

Utfør følgende kommando i MacOS -terminalen for å begynne Homebrew Package Manager -installasjon:

/bin/bash -c "$ (curl -fssl https: // rå.GitHubUserContent.com/homebrew/install/head/installer.sh) "

Ovennevnte skript vil installere hjemmebrygget i /usr/lokal/ katalog.

II: Hvordan installere Homebrew på en M1 Mac

Ovennevnte trinn vil installere homebrew i /opt/homebrew/ Katalog hvis Mac er Apple Silicon -basert (M1/M2).

På M1 eller M2 Mac -er er det et ekstra trinn å følge for å installere hjemmebrygg. Som standard lastes homebrew lastet ned i /opt /homebrew -katalogen. Denne katalogen er ikke en del av miljøvariabelen ($ bane).

For å gjøre denne katalogen til en del av miljøvariabelen, utfør følgende kommando på Apple Silicon -baserte Mac -er:

ekko 'eval "$ (/opt/homebrew/bin/brew shellenv)"' >> ~//.Zprofile
eval "$ (/opt/homebrew/bin/brew shellenv)"

Alternativt kan du åpne Zprofile fil i Nano Redaktør ved hjelp av kommando:

sudo nano ~/.Zprofile

Legg nå til følgende linje i filen og lagre den:

eval "$ (/opt/homebrew/bin/brew shellenv)"

Merk: Homebrew installasjonsguide i denne artikkelen er for MacOS 11.X Big Sur. Homebrew støttes ikke offisielt på de eldre versjonene av macOS, men det kan fungere på macos Mojave og Catalina.

For å bekrefte Homebrew -installasjonen, bruk kommandoen gitt nedenfor:

Brygg -Versjon

For å oppdatere homebrew til den nyeste versjonen, bruk:

Bryggoppdatering

For hjelp relatert til Homebrew, utfør:

Brygg -hjelp

For å lese Homebrew Man -siden Bruk:

mann brygg

Hvordan bruke homebrew på mac

Homebrew kommer med mange kommandoer for å administrere pakker, noen ofte brukte kommandoer er diskutert i følgende avsnitt:

Installasjonspakke

For å installere en formel eller pakke, bruk følgende syntaks:

Brygg installasjon

Merk: For homebrew pakker brukes formelbetegnelse; Det gir instruksjoner for homebrew å installere pakker.

For eksempel for å installere WGET verktøy erstattet med WGET I kommandoen ovenfor:

Brygg install WGET

Installere fat

Du kan også installere GUI -baserte apper ved hjelp av homebrew, for den bruker følgende syntaks:

Brygginstallasjon -KASK

Merk: For å installere MacOS -innfødte pakker, bruker Homebrew Cask Definition.

For eksempel for å installere Firefox Browser, bruk:

Brygg installasjon -Cask Firefox

Liste over installerte pakker

For å sjekke de installerte pakkene, kan vi liste opp de hjemmebryte installerte pakkene ved hjelp av:

bryggeliste

Avinstallere pakker

For å avinstallere Homebrew-pakken, følg syntaks gitt-below:

Brygg avinstallering

Å fjerne WGET Pakkebruk:

Brygg avinstallerer WGET

For å fjerne en fask, bruk følgende syntaks:

Brygg avinstallering -påkasken

For å slette Firefox Cask Bytt ut :

Brygg avinstallering -Cask Firefox

Kontrollerer pakkeavhengigheter

For å sjekke avhengighetene til en spesifikk pakke, bruk kommandoen som er nevnt nedenfor:

Brew Deps

For eksempel å sjekke avhengighetene til WGET, henrette:

Brew Deps Wget

Oppdatering av pakker

For å oppdatere en spesifikk hjemmebryggepakke, bruk følgende syntaks:

Bryggoppdatering

Liste over utdaterte pakker

For å liste over de utdaterte pakkene, bruk følgende kommando i terminalen:

Brygg utdatert

Fjerne unødvendige avhengigheter

For å fjerne uønskede avhengigheter, bruk:

Brygg autoremove--tørk

Oppføring av hjemmebryggefeil og advarsler

For å liste opp hjemmebryggefeil og problemer, bruk kommandoen gitt nedenfor:

Brygg lege

Hvordan du avinstallerer hjemmebrygg fra Mac

Hvis du ikke lenger trenger en pakkeansvarlig for din Mac som kjører MacOS Mojave eller senere, kan Homebrew enkelt fjernes ved å bruke den gitte kommandoen nedenfor:

/bin/bash -c "$ (curl -fssl https: // rå.GitHubUserContent.com/homebrew/install/head/avinstaller.sh) "

Hvordan du avinstallerer xcode -kommandolinjeverktøy

For å avinstallere Xcode -kommandolinjeverktøy kjører kommandoen gitt nedenfor i terminalen:

sudo rm -rf/bibliotek/utvikler/commandlinetools

Konklusjon

MacOS kommer ikke med noen pakkebehandler, det meste av programvaren er installert ved hjelp av GUI. Homebrew er en pakkebehandler som gjør det enkelt å installere pakker på macOS gjennom Command Line -grensesnittet. Det er ganske nyttig med å installere utviklerverktøy og til og med innfødte macOS open source GUI-applikasjoner.